


Pattaya’s cost of living is one of its strongest arguments for relocation. The city’s long history as an expat destination has created a competitive market where accommodation, dining, and services are priced for a mixed local-and-expat economy. The result is a coastal lifestyle meaningfully more affordable than Phuket while offering significantly more infrastructure than smaller Thai beach towns.
Studio or one-bedroom in Jomtien or Naklua: $350-$600/month. Daily local food and occasional Thai restaurant meals: $200-$350/month. Baht bus and occasional Grab: $50-$100/month. Health insurance: $100-$200/month. Local entertainment and activities: $100-$200/month.
Budget Coastal Life: $1,000 to $1,500 per month — exceptional beach lifestyle value for retirees and remote workers
Quality one-bedroom or two-bedroom condo with sea view and pool: $600-$1,200/month. Mix of Western and local dining: $400-$600/month. Motorbike or rental plus car hire for larger trips: $200-$400/month. Golf, entertainment, activities: $300-$500/month.
Comfortable Pattaya Life: $1,800 to $2,800 per month — ideal for retirees and those seeking coastal comfort
• Studio in Naklua or Jomtien: $300-$500 per month
• One-bedroom sea-view condo (Jomtien): $500-$900 per month
• Two-bedroom condo with pool: $700-$1,400 per month
• House with garden (East Pattaya): $700-$1,200 per month
• Thai street food meal: $1.50-$3
• Local Thai restaurant: $3-$7
• Western pub or bar food: $8-$18
• International restaurant dinner: $15-$35
• Golf (green fee): $35-$80

• Golf with caddie: $50-$100
• Gym membership: $20-$50 per month
• Motorbike rental: $60-$90 per month
• Baht bus ride: $0.50-$1
